I have a great story from yesterday. Two young Montague area residents did me an amazing favor yesterday.
I got the sled stuck on deep single track a good couple of hours before dark. At sundown I gave up and I had to walk out 4-miles to a road with little sled and no car traffic. These two guys offered to go get my sled for no money, even though I offered it!
One of them left me with his expensive sled running, to keep my hands warm! I didn't know these two young twenty somethings at all!
15-min.'s later out they come with my sled! And they then bought me a warm drink at the nearest warm place, the Montague Inn. These two "locals" love sledding and the out of town visitors. I hate to see all the bashing of locals on the sledding forums. Things like "dumb hillbillies", "they hates us", "they only want our money", ect.
These two saved my dumb 50-year old butt and retrieved my sled, at night, no less. And wouldn't take a thing for it.
